2 student from Universiti Utara Malaysia,  Looi Pui Mun & Tan Yi Wen, made a name for Malaysia at international level by getting the highest marks in the ACCA exams.

looi pui mun e1643335055891

 

Looi Pui Mun who is a graduate of Bachelor of Accounting (Information Systems) obtained the highest marks for the Advanced Financial Management (AFM) paper in December 2021.

The achievement places Pui Mun at 1st place in the world and in Malaysia. 

“I am pleased with the achievement and did not even expect to reach that level for the final paper to complete the ACCA program.”

According to Pui Mun, despite the COVID-19 situation still not coming to an end, it does not seem like a problem for her. Instead an advantage for her to spend more time on studying after completing her internship.

tan yi wen e1643335036770

 

Whereas, Tan Yi Wen places 1st place in Malaysia and 14th place globally!

Tan Yi Wen, is a final year student of the Bachelor of Accounting and she obtained the highest marks for the Advanced Performance Management (APM) paper December 2021.

“I was excited and surprised at the same time because I did not expect to get the highest marks in Malaysia. All the efforts have finally paid off, but there’s still a long journey for me to complete the exam papers for this ACCA program.”

Yi Wen stated that to her discipline is important to achieve such achievement. She explains that she finishes her assignments first, then proceeds to watch class recordings, review and practice questions from previous years.
